Latest Patents: Among Burbar's latest innovations are two key patents that illustrate his expertise in cooling systems for imaging technology. The first patent describes a modular, scalable cooling system for a diagnostic medical imaging apparatus. This fluid coolant system is designed for a gantry of a medical imaging apparatus, effectively cooling scalable detector electronic assemblies (DEAs) within the gantry. Each DEA features a first chill plate dedicated to cooling detector elements and a second chill plate for electronic components and power supplies. The coolant flow cascades sequentially through these plates, optimizing the cooling process and enhancing the overall efficiency of the imaging system.

The second patent focuses on a method for performing a partial scan using a PET/CT system. This innovative approach enables the selection of a region of interest for scanning, where a CT scan is performed to acquire raw CT data, which is then reconstructed into images. The PET/CT system is tailored to limit data collection specifically to this region, allowing for a focused PET scan that acquires raw PET data and reconstructs it into PET images of the area of interest.
